Fig. 10

Poincaré sections of the dynamics driven by both the planetary and galactic perturbations (Hamiltonian from Eq. (13)). The semi-major axis taken as parameter is
a = 500 au. The colour scale shows the maximum orbital change rate between two successive points (see titles), and the grey zones are forbidden. Top: section for au2yr−2
at ΩG = 0 decreasing. The islands located at e ≈ 0.8 are due to the resonance 2ω + Ω, and the islands located at e ≈ 0.2 are due to librations of ω
while I ≈ 63o
(Lidov–Kozai mechanism). Bottom: section for
au2yr−2
at ωG = 0 decreasing. The chaotic bands are due to the overlap of the resonances ω − Ω
and 2ω − Ω
(for I < 90o), or ω + Ω
and 2ω + Ω
(for I > 90o), and the islands located at I ≈ 90o
are due to librations of Ω
(orthogonal Laplace plane).
